    Complete your Addiction Studies, Associate in Applied Science-Transfer (AAS-T). This program's competencies can be attained through an extensive array of educational courses offered. The program contains classes suggested to begin internships in chemical dependency agencies in the public and private sectors and fulfill chemical dependency professional status in accordance with current certification requirements. Course content includes counseling, case management, psychology, sociology, ethics, law, and physiology as well as internships in a variety of work environments. Students are encouraged to begin the program in either the fall or winter quarter. The AAS-T option may improve the transferability of Associate in Applied Science (AAS) degrees to some four-year programs.

    Associate in Science in Administration of Justice for Transfer (AS-T) The Associate in Science in Administration of Justice for Transfer (AS-T in Administration of Justice) is designed to provide a clear pathway to a CSU institution for students who plan to transfer and complete a CSU major or baccalaureate degree in Administration of Justice. The Associate in Science in Administration of Justice for Transfer (AS-T in Administration of Justice) is an innovative social science program that emphasizes critical thinking about corrections, crime and delinquency, legal studies, and working with diverse communities. This multidisciplinary program explores the connections between law, crime, and justice.

    The Homeland Security Emergency Management (HSEM) associate degree program is designed to prepare the next generation of emergency management and policy leaders with the knowledge and skills they need to improve outcomes in disasters of all types. This online degree program includes instruction in policy as well as planning and operational components of emergency management and homeland security, including opportunities to gain practical experience and work with current incident management technologies. The curriculum provides policy foundations and advances students through core competencies in hazard identification; risk and vulnerability assessment; planning; terrorism; mitigation, preparedness, response, and recovery; and planning for diverse populations.

    The associate of science degree program provides students with a broad academic education to prepare them for the workplace and for upper-level university study. The degree requirements for the associate of science may be met through LCCC’s university transfer courses or by taking university transfer courses at other recognized colleges and/or universities. Since requirements at transfer institutions vary widely, students should consult the catalog of the transfer institution and plan their program with an advisor. Select from the general education/transfer module: English composition; Social and behavioral sciences; Arts and humanities; Mathematics/statistics/logic and natural sciences.

    Since September 11, 2001, the security industry has expanded rapidly. The United States Department of Homeland Security employs more than 180,000 individuals. Coupled with that, the private security industry employs nearly 1.5 million security personnel. The homeland security degree program is focused on providing students with a foundation of private and homeland security knowledge to build upon as a transfer to a specialty degree. The objectives of the homeland security associate degree program are to upgrade personnel employed in the security industry and to prepare students for full-time employment in this field.
